Thank you for posting in the Apple Support Communities. We understand that an error occurs when playing music in your library on your iOS device, and we'd like to help.


For this issue, we suggest taking steps 1-3 here: If an app on your iPhone or iPad stops responding, closes unexpectedly, or won’t open. Oftentimes, closing then reopening the app, restarting your iPhone, and checking for updates can help.


From there, try playing both downloaded and streamed music to help identify a connectivity issue. If this happens with streamed content, we suggest connecting to Wi-Fi, then try playing your music again. Likewise, if this is with downloaded content, remove the songs or album, then download it again from Apple Music.


We also suggest testing the issue with and without headphones (both wired and wireless). This step works to isolate a hardware issue.


If this concern still isn't resolved after taking each of these steps, we recommend that you contact Apple Support directly. Depending on your region, you may be able to reach them here:
